What is Emergency Boarding Up?
Emergency boarding up refers to the procedure of protecting windows, doors, and other gain access to points of a property with boards or other materials, producing a barrier against additional damage. This safety measure is frequently required after:
Natural catastrophes such as hurricanes or tornadoesActs of vandalism or theftFire damageAccidental damage of windows or doors
By boarding up a property, owners can avoid ecological elements, undesirable gain access to, and extra damage, while also providing a sense of security throughout healing.
Why is Emergency Boarding Up Important?
The significance of emergency boarding up can not be overstated. Several aspects highlight its vital role in property management:

Protection from the Elements: After disasters, properties are susceptible to rain, wind, and debris, which can worsen damage.

Deterrence to Crime: An unsecured property might attract criminal activities. Boarding up can help deter potential robbers or vandals.

Insurance coverage Compliance: Many insurance plan require measures to mitigate damage following a loss. Stopping working to board up might lead to disputes throughout the claims process.

Preservation of Property Value: By taking instant steps to secure a property, owners can influence the property's general value, especially if it is on the market.
The Process of Emergency Boarding Up
The process of boarding up a property can differ depending on the degree of the damage and the structure's layout. The list below actions detail a general method:
1. Evaluation of Damage
Before any boards are positioned, an assessment of the situation is vital. This consists of identifying:
[Broken Window Repair](https://posteezy.com/emergency-window-replacement-same-everyone-says) windows or doorsAreas prone to leakages or wind damageThe total stability of the property2. Gathering Materials
Common materials utilized in emergency boarding up consist of:
Plywood sheets (or OSB)Heavy-duty screws or boltsHammer or impact motoristSaw (to cut boards to size)Safety gear (gloves, safety glasses)3. Protecting Entry Points
Once products are ready, begin boarding up by following these guidelines:
Windows: Measure the window frame and cut the plywood to size. Securely fasten it over the [Broken Window Repair](https://more-ruserialov.net/user/chequeneed16/) glass using screws.Doors: Use thicker plywood for doors, and make sure that it extends at least a couple of inches past the doorframe.4. Final Inspection
After boarding up, conduct a last assessment to ensure that all points are secure and that no gaps stay. This action is important for decreasing future danger.

1. The length of time does it take to board up a property?

The time needed to board up a property depends on the level of the damage, but it typically varies from a couple of hours to a complete day.

2. Can I recycle plywood once it has been used for boarding up?

Yes, if the plywood remains undamaged and intact, it can be recycled for future emergencies or other tasks.

3. Exist alternative approaches for boarding up?

Some property owners opt for plastic sheeting or specialized [Window Protection](https://www.glassyun58.com/home.php?mod=space&uid=842244) film for weather condition protection, however these might not use the same level of security as plywood.

4. Should I contact my insurance company before boarding up?

It's recommended to record the damage and communicate with your insurance company for guidance before taking any action.
